The Czech Republic`s import trend for hybrid seeds in the Czech Republic market experienced a -2.4% growth rate from 2023 to 2024,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.21% for the period 2020-2024. This decline in import momentum could be attributed to shifting demand patterns or evolving trade policies impacting market stability.

In the Czech Republic Hybrid Seeds Market, one of the main challenges faced is the presence of a relatively small agricultural sector compared to other European countries, leading to limited demand for hybrid seeds. This results in lower economies of scale for seed companies operating in the market, impacting their profitability and ability to invest in research and development. Additionally, there are regulatory hurdles related to seed certification and intellectual property rights protection that can hinder market entry for new players and limit competition. The market is also influenced by factors such as climate change, fluctuating prices of agricultural commodities, and evolving consumer preferences, which can create uncertainty and volatility for both seed producers and farmers.
